1. Check the Burger King Website for Job Openings
The first step in getting a job at Burger King is to check their official website for job openings. Burger King posts all available positions on their website, making it easy for applicants to search and apply for jobs online. You can filter your search by location, job title, and category to find the perfect opportunity. Make sure to create a profile and upload your resume to increase your chances of getting noticed by the hiring team.
Burger King uses an applicant tracking system (ATS) to manage job applications. To ensure your application passes through the ATS, use keywords from the job posting in your resume and cover letter. For example, if the job posting mentions "customer service skills," make sure to include that phrase in your application materials.
What to Expect from the Online Application Process
The online application process for Burger King is straightforward and user-friendly. You will be asked to provide basic information, such as your name, contact information, and work history. You will also be required to answer a series of questions about your qualifications and experience. Make sure to answer these questions honestly and thoroughly, as this information will be used to determine your eligibility for the job.

2. Visit a Burger King Location and Ask to Speak with a Manager
Another effective way to get a job at Burger King is to visit a location in person and ask to speak with a manager. This approach shows initiative and allows you to make a personal impression on the hiring manager. Be prepared to discuss your qualifications and experience, and bring a copy of your resume and references.
When visiting a Burger King location, dress professionally and be respectful of the staff and customers. A positive attitude and friendly demeanor can go a long way in making a good impression. Don't be afraid to ask questions about the job and the company culture.
Tips for In-Person Interviews
When meeting with a manager in person, be prepared to talk about your skills and experience. Bring specific examples of times when you demonstrated excellent customer service, teamwork, or leadership skills. Show enthusiasm for the company and the role, and ask thoughtful questions about the position.

What is the hiring process like at Burger King?
+The hiring process at Burger King typically involves an online application, followed by an in-person interview with a manager. The company may also conduct background checks and verify employment history.
What are the most common jobs at Burger King?
+The most common jobs at Burger King include crew members, shift managers, and assistant managers. The company may also hire for specialized positions, such as marketing or finance.
Does Burger King offer training for new employees?
+Yes, Burger King offers comprehensive training for new employees, including classroom instruction and on-the-job training. The company may also provide ongoing training and development opportunities for employees.
